Clint D. Brown's Obituary
MARSHALL, IL - Clint David Brown, age 43 of Marshall and formerly of Charleston, passed away on Wednesday, December 30, 2015 at Union Hospital in Terre Haute, IN. Family and friends are invited to attend a celebration of his life to be held on Saturday, January 9, 2016 from 1:00 - 4:00 p.m. at the Charleston Elks located at 720 Sixth Street in Charleston. Food and beverages will be available and memorial gifts in his honor may be made to Chris Brown to assist with final expenses. Gifts may be left during the celebration or may be mailed to Adams Funeral Chapel, 2330 Shawnee Dr., Charleston, IL 61920. Clint was born January 5, 1972 in Charleston, IL to David and Donna (McNary) Brown. Clint is survived by his children, Reagan Brown of Effingham, IL and Lance Brown of Marshall, IL; a stepson, Ethan Ballinger of Effingham; his mother, Donna Owen of Charleston; his father, David Brown of TN; a brother, Chris Brown and wife Jill of Charleston; an uncle, Raymond McNary of Charleston; 3 nieces and 2 nephews and their families; and close friends, Harold Woods and Ed and Paula Hart. He was preceded in death by his grandparents and his stepfather, Dale Owen. Clint, known as ""Cliffy"" to many, was a graduate of Charleston High School and for the past 5 years has been employed with North American Lighting in Paris, IL. He was a member of AA having successfully completing the program and was an avid Green Bay Packers fan.
